When interest rates are low, small-cap stocks begin to shine and outpace larger companies in value. These stocks are stocks with a market capitalization between $300 million and $3 billion.
IPC Indice de Precios Y Cotizaciones 51,510.68-216.20-0.42% ...
e.l.f. Beauty Inc. $70.10-3.94-5.32% ...
The Constitutional and Law Reform Commission (CLRC) has confirmed it is engaged in preliminary discussions with the University of Papua New Guinea (UPNG) regarding the potential restoration and ...